if you're trying to update from existing windows installation, then don't, and do a fresh install instead (remove or rename all system files)
if you have an exotic scsi/raid controller, and there is a driver for it, use it
might be that the one with vista is buggy
or disconnect ALL but essential hardware from your comp
this was a common fix for early windows 95 and 2000 installations when the installer was really buggy and couldn't detect hardware right
so that's only the videocard required for the monitor
all other cards can easily be unplugged for the duration of the installation
then add them one by one if the install was a success
installing motherboard drivers before adding any cards might be a good idea aswell
if they work on vista yet
